summ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Jeroen van Meeuwen (Kolab Systems) <vanmeeuwen@kolabsys.com>2016-02-03 10:42:01 +0100
committerJeroen van Meeuwen (Kolab Systems) <vanmeeuwen@kolabsys.com>2016-02-03 10:42:01 +0100
commit772d814e1ca51975d95b30103776f129278f30b6 (patch)
tree57a08cfbc5936a2cd66d56604ad5ff993d904e04
parentb9477d3a49ab5ca57760141e10c43f9e9605691f (diff)
downloaddocker-772d814e1ca51975d95b30103776f129278f30b6.tar.gz
Add additional ci images mostly for installation testing at this point
-rw-r--r--99-ci-jessie/Dockerfile15
-rw-r--r--99-ci-jessie/kolab.list2
-rw-r--r--99-ci-trusty/Dockerfile15
-rw-r--r--99-ci-trusty/kolab.list2
-rw-r--r--99-ci-xenial/Dockerfile15
-rw-r--r--99-ci-xenial/kolab.list2
6 files changed, 51 insertions, 0 deletions
diff --git a/99-ci-jessie/Dockerfile b/99-ci-jessie/Dockerfile
new file mode 100644
index 0000000..4f69638
--- /dev/null
+++ b/99-ci-jessie/Dockerfile
@@ -0,0 +1,15 @@
+FROM docker.io/debian:jessie
+
+MAINTAINER Jeroen van Meeuwen <vanmeeuwen@kolabsys.com>
+
+ENV DEBIAN_FRONTEND noninteractive
+
+RUN apt-get update && \
+ apt-get -y install wget
+
+ADD /kolab.list /etc/apt/sources.list.d/kolab.list
+
+RUN wget -q -O- http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Debian_8.0/Release.key | apt-key add -
+
+RUN apt-get update && \
+ apt-get -y install kolab
diff --git a/99-ci-jessie/kolab.list b/99-ci-jessie/kolab.list
new file mode 100644
index 0000000..fd3bdef
--- /dev/null
+++ b/99-ci-jessie/kolab.list
@@ -0,0 +1,2 @@
+deb http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Debian_8.0/ ./
+deb-src http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Debian_8.0/ ./
diff --git a/99-ci-trusty/Dockerfile b/99-ci-trusty/Dockerfile
new file mode 100644
index 0000000..7d97f5a
--- /dev/null
+++ b/99-ci-trusty/Dockerfile
@@ -0,0 +1,15 @@
+FROM docker.io/ubuntu:trusty
+
+MAINTAINER Jeroen van Meeuwen <vanmeeuwen@kolabsys.com>
+
+ENV DEBIAN_FRONTEND noninteractive
+
+RUN apt-get update && \
+ apt-get -y install wget
+
+ADD /kolab.list /etc/apt/sources.list.d/kolab.list
+
+RUN wget -q -O- http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Ubuntu_14.04/Release.key | apt-key add -
+
+RUN apt-get update && \
+ apt-get -y install kolab
diff --git a/99-ci-trusty/kolab.list b/99-ci-trusty/kolab.list
new file mode 100644
index 0000000..da705a9
--- /dev/null
+++ b/99-ci-trusty/kolab.list
@@ -0,0 +1,2 @@
+deb http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Ubuntu_14.04/ ./
+deb-src http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Ubuntu_14.04/ ./
diff --git a/99-ci-xenial/Dockerfile b/99-ci-xenial/Dockerfile
new file mode 100644
index 0000000..adf7b08
--- /dev/null
+++ b/99-ci-xenial/Dockerfile
@@ -0,0 +1,15 @@
+FROM docker.io/ubuntu:xenial
+
+MAINTAINER Jeroen van Meeuwen <vanmeeuwen@kolabsys.com>
+
+ENV DEBIAN_FRONTEND noninteractive
+
+RUN apt-get update && \
+ apt-get -y install wget
+
+ADD /kolab.list /etc/apt/sources.list.d/kolab.list
+
+RUN wget -q -O- http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Ubuntu_16.04/Release.key | apt-key add -
+
+RUN apt-get update && \
+ apt-get -y install kolab || :
diff --git a/99-ci-xenial/kolab.list b/99-ci-xenial/kolab.list
new file mode 100644
index 0000000..4b945b7
--- /dev/null
+++ b/99-ci-xenial/kolab.list
@@ -0,0 +1,2 @@
+deb http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Ubuntu_16.04/ ./
+deb-src http://obs.kolabsys.com/repositories/Kolab:/Winterfell/Ubuntu_16.04/ ./